We arrived in Marahau in order to walk on the Abel Tasman...
We arrived in Marahau in order to walk on the Abel Tasman track. It is a small township, and we enjoyed walking down to the bay for the sunset. We had chosen the Aqua taxi to transport us up to the start of our walk, and enjoyed the efficiency and novelty of that experience. Just a warning to other travellers, By mid May, the little township is settling in for the ‘off’ season, which means that there are fewer grocery and eating options. We had been forewarned and had collected groceries at Motueka.Guest review bySneddleAustralia - 10.0

St arnaud is the starting point for discovering the delights...
St arnaud is the starting point for discovering the delights of Nelson Lakes National Park. The town and the surroundings are extremely picturesque and the walks in the national park remain some of my favourites in the South Island. Beautiful beech forests. Also very nearby are dedicated mountain bike trails that are great fun.Guest review byFrankieNew Zealand - 10.0
